Output 18c63128129d4866eb374daf9512b470ea111dff63301e26110b1a6e9cbf7d53:0

value
99219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ef605e89ce69942438fdcfb7e03b31e9b5125b1 OP_EQUAL
address
3EivbmSRPbtvUSdustyKkEJjPZ9wHx96kz
transaction
18c63128129d4866eb374daf9512b470ea111dff63301e26110b1a6e9cbf7d53